"Though it’s best known for its quality selection of seafood, Shaw’s is offering an a la carte menu of seafood favorites and seasonal Thanksgiving dishes for the holiday that includes herb-roasted Turkey breast with brioche stuffing with sides for $37. Housemade pumpkin and pecan pie will be available by the slice. Groups of 6-12 order a 3-course prix fixe Thanksgiving feast featuring the whole King Crab “carved” tableside for $100 per person. Book a table here." - Lisa Shames, Eater Staff

Being longtime Lettuce Entertain You aficionados and fans of both Shaw's locations, the Missus and I have enjoyed many celebratory occasions here. Shaw's legendary Sunday seafood brunch buffet was stymied by the pandemic but the dinner menu remains robust, both old school and trendy. The ageless '40s décor continues to delight and service is thoroughly polished. On this visit, I began with an expertly prepared classic Caesar salad, my Missus enjoyed a cup of hearty seafood gumbo, and her sis had a cup of New England clam chowder (which would've benefited from more clam and less potato). We requested bread and our server brought a basket of warm melt-in-your-mouth Parker House rolls. The Missus and I feasted on pan seared Lake Erie Walleye. Plated with charred green beans and fennel atop lemon grass beurre blanc, this entrée was divine. Her sis had the grilled Atlantic yellowfin tuna. Our server recommended ordering it rare. Anointed with a delicate ginger-soy vinaigrette, it elicited a super-WOW. We shared a side of pungent garlic mashed potatoes. I received a comp dessert for my birthday, a generous slab of key lime pie. Dessert doesn't get any better than this.
